This is how it works
When a potential customer browses your site and clicks on the pictures, all they have to do is hit 'attach file' and they will see the file (if it is a graphic), 'enter information', and click on 'send' to see how it works, everyone will be amazed.
You don't have to be a computer wizard or need special programming skills to make this script functional. All you have to do is install a Flash Attach form on your website. After making a couple of changes in the .php file, place the .swf, emailattach.php and upload.php files on your website in the same directory.
If you want to keep files on your server, the script automatically defaults to auto-delete from your server the moment a user hits the send button. If you want to keep files and delete them on your own, all you have to do is simple delete the second to the last line in the emailattach.php.
